Recommendations

Building Assertiveness

  1. Identify Needs and Wants: Kevin should begin by listing situations in which he feels his needs are not being met. This exercise will help him articulate his desires and understand areas where he can practice assertiveness.

  2. Role-Playing: Engaging in role-playing exercises with a trusted friend or family member can provide Kevin with a safe space to practice assertive communication. This can help him become more comfortable in expressing his thoughts and feelings in real-life situations.

  3. Use “I” Statements: Encouraging Kevin to use “I” statements when communicating can assist in framing his thoughts in a personal context. For example, instead of saying “You never listen to me,” he could express that “I feel unheard when I share my ideas.” This approach reduces defensiveness from the listener.

  4. Start Small: Kevin should begin practicing assertiveness in low-stakes situations, such as during casual conversations with colleagues or friends. Gradually, he can move towards more significant interactions with his supervisor, building his confidence along the way.

  5. Seek Feedback: After conversations, Kevin can ask for feedback from trusted colleagues about his communication style. This feedback will provide insight and help him adjust and improve his assertiveness skills.
